In his later years, Mr. Liang Shuming accepted an interview with an American scholar, and the content was compiled into a book titled "Will the World Be Better?" "It can be said that the title of this book is the common wish of Chinese scholars for more than two thousand years, that is, to improve the world through personal efforts. This is called the "Spirit of Shushi", and Confucius is the representative of this spirit. Confucius was originally an official in the Lu State, and he did a good job, but because the monarch and his ministers could not cooperate, he hung up the crown and left, traveled around the country, and took his students everywhere.Once they came to a river and couldn't find a ferry. They saw two people plowing fields nearby. Confucius asked Zilu to ask for directions.Zilu went, and asked the first person, where is the ferry?The man didn't answer directly. He saw Confucius sitting on the carriage from a distance, holding the rein, and asked Zilu, who is the person holding the whip in the carriage?Zilu said, it was Confucius from the state of Lu.The man said, Confucius knew where the ferry was.What does that mean?It means that even those who lived in seclusion at that time heard that Confucius took his students to travel around the world. Their evaluation of Confucius was that Confucius knew where the ferry of life was and how to cross the river.That is to say, he admits that he has a far-sighted vision and knows where the society is going to develop and where the way out is. It is only because the times are wrong that it is difficult for him to move forward.

Zilu couldn't get an answer, so he asked the second person.The man heard their conversation and asked Zilu, who are you?Zilu said, I am a student of Confucius.The man said: "The eloquent is everywhere in the world, but who will change it? And instead of following the people who pioneered people, how can we follow the scholars who pioneered the world?" ("The Analects of Confucius") The world is in chaos, everywhere All the same, who can change it?You follow Confucius who is running away from the bad guys, why not follow me who is running away from the bad world!After finishing speaking, continue to plow the field and ignore him.Zilu went back and reported the situation to Confucius. Confucius knew that the two were hermits.

The Master said in a daze: "Birds and beasts should not be in the same flock, but who will be with me if I am a man? There is a way in the world, and it is not easy to be with Qiu." ("The Analects of Confucius") Confucius said with a sad expression: "We can't live with birds and beasts. If we get along with different groups of people, who should we get along with? If the politics of the world are on the right track, I won't take you to try to change it." This sentence fully expresses the Confucian "Spirit of Shushi", and shows the sense of mission of an intellectual, which is "doing what is impossible", knowing that the ideal cannot be realized, but still doing it, why?Because escaping is not the best way, if everyone retreats to the mountains and forests to seek personal freedom, what will this society do?There is no way in the world, and it needs intellectuals to work hard to improve it. Even though they know that their power is limited and no matter what they do, they will not be able to achieve the state of world harmony, but they still refuse to give up.Therefore, the wisdom of Confucianism is not manifested in liberation, but manifested in: in the appropriate time and environment, in the appropriate way to achieve the ideal result.This is the ability to "choose good" and "good choice", and its basis is: if you don't do this, you can't feel at ease.

Confucius took his students to the state of Wei, where there was a dispute at that time.Kuai Kui, the prince of Wei Linggong, offended Wei Linggong's wife Nanzi, who drove him abroad.When Wei Linggong died, his grandson Wei Chugong took over the throne.This time, the son did not become the king, but the grandson inherited the throne. Of course, the son would come back to fight for the throne, resulting in a situation where father and son competed for the throne.When Confucius went, Wei Chugong had been in power for several years.Zilu asked the teacher, the state of Wei is in such a mess, if you were to be in charge of politics, what would you do first?Generally speaking, we would choose to do a good job in the economy first, and then talk about other things, but Confucius didn't see it that way. The Master said: "The name must also be corrected!" Zi Lu said: "Yes, it is true, the son's deviousness! Do you want to be correct?" The Master said: "If the name is not correct, the words will not be right; if the words are not right, things will fail; If rituals and music are not flourishing, if rituals and music are not flourishing, the criminal law will fail, and if the criminal law fails, the people will be at a loss." ("The Analects of Confucius·Zilu") Confucius said: "If I have to do it, it is to correct the name!" Zilu said: "You are too pedantic! What can I correct?" Confucius said: "You are so reckless! A gentleman does not understand himself If the status is not corrected, the speech will not be smooth; if the speech is not smooth, the official affairs will not be done; if the official affairs are not completed, the ritual and music will not be on track; If there is a certain standard, the people will panic and be at a loss." This passage is very logical. "Must also rectify the name!" became the first consideration of Confucius in politics.Politics is about managing people's affairs, so what does it have to do with "rectification of names"?This is one of the keys to understanding Confucianism. There are two kinds of "name", one is name and reality, and the other is name.A name is a name, and a "table" is a name; a table is in front of you, which is a fact.When we usually talk about names and facts, it is relatively simple. For example, what is the name of this person?He said my name is so-and-so.So-and-so is connected with this person.Everything has a name, and everyone can grasp it as long as they know it objectively.Fame returns to the duty corresponding to a name, which means matching a certain identity, role, and status, and there must be certain proportions, requirements, and standards in it.Because the greatest feature of the human world is that besides what is, what should be, what is actually what it is, what should be is what it should be.If you only talk about what is true and don't ask what should be, society will have no rules and will be chaotic.Therefore, Confucius' "name is right and sound" is considered from the perspective of "name". When Confucius was in Qi State, Duke Jing of Qi once asked him, how should politics be promoted?Confucius said eight words: Junjun, ministers, father and son, son and son.The first "jun" is the name, which is the current monarch, and the second "jun" is the duty, which is the ideal monarch, which means that if you have the name of the monarch, you must have the ideal performance of the monarch, and you must learn from Yao, Shun and Yu. .The same is true for ministers, fathers, sons and sons, which can be translated as: "The ruler should be like the king, the minister should be like the minister, the father should be like the father, and the son should be like a son." After hearing this, Duke Jing of Qi thought it made sense, and said, "That's good. Belief is like a king is not a king, ministers are not ministers, fathers are not fathers, sons are not sons, although there is millet, I can eat it?" ("The Analects of Confucius Yan Yuan") If the king is not like the king, the ministers are not like the ministers, the father is not Like the father, the son is not like the son, even if the country has a lot of food, can I eat it?It means that everyone has to settle down and fulfill their responsibilities, so that the society can be stable and harmonious. Now Chugong Wei is the king, and his father, the crown prince, has returned from abroad and thinks that he should be the king.Both sides think their own is right, and the other party lacks legitimacy and legitimacy.Who should inherit the throne?Does the first one win?Is it okay to obtain status by illegal means?It is necessary to figure out who is the ruler and who is the minister, otherwise the chaos will continue.Therefore, Confucius said that the issue of governing and defending the country must first be "rectified", and the names between the monarch and his ministers, father and son, should be corrected.Otherwise, if the name is not corrected, the speech will not be smooth.Because you speak according to your identity, what role you play, and what you say must conform to the corresponding role.How can you advance the affairs of the state if words are not of standing?If the official business cannot be done, the rites and music will not be on track.Ritual and music are the expression of proper relationship between people. If the ritual and music are not on track, the penalty will lose a certain standard. In the end, the common people will do whatever they want, causing chaos in the world.The world is in chaos, and you, the king, will not be able to live well. Therefore, Confucianism attaches great importance to the name, and only when the name is correct can the words be smooth.No matter what kind of status a person has, what he says will have the appropriate effect, and you cannot exceed your authority.Suppose you are just a secretary and you want to speak for the boss, that is not acceptable, unless you have explicit authorization, otherwise what you say only represents the secretary.The so-called "only tools and names, not fake people", if names are randomly added to inappropriate people, he will misuse and abuse them, causing problems.Similarly, if you have a certain status, you must try your best to meet the standards required by this status.Only when everyone fulfills his responsibilities and fulfills his duties can society be stable.The same is true in politics. The name and status must be corrected first, and the following series can be followed by smooth words, successful affairs, rituals and music, and criminal law, so that ordinary people know how to live and develop. There are three families of doctors in the state of Lu: the Meng family, the Shu family, and the Ji family.Their children are hereditary, and they will be officials when they are born.Especially the Ji family, who have great power.By the time of Ji Kangzi, he was in his twenties and had already become the Minister of Lu.At this time, Confucius was serving as a national advisor. Ji Kangzi, a young official, came to ask Confucius for advice on how to engage in politics.Confucius' answer is simple: politicians are righteous.Zi Shuai is righteous, who dares to be unrighteous? ("The Analects of Confucius Yan Yuan") Zheng means righteousness, and those in power take the lead on the right path. Who would dare not to walk on the right path?In other words, if political leaders do not take the right path, will the people of the world not despair?These words are the expectations of an old man for a young man, but the young man may only think about how to use the power in his hands. Hearing that he must first act upright and sit upright, he will probably feel a lot of pressure.At that time, there were many robbers in the state of Lu. Ji Kangzi asked again, what should I do if there are too many robbers?Confucius said: "If a dog does not desire, he will not steal even if he is rewarded." ("The Analects of Confucius Yan Yuan") If you yourself are not greedy for money, even if you are rewarded, others will not be robbers.What's the meaning?Because those in positions of power are greedy, some people are forced to make a living or learn from others, so they become robbers.Conversely, if the leaders are not so greedy, the people will also have a sense of shame and self-respect and self-love.Confucius said this very frankly, even a bit exaggerated, the purpose is to make the politicians wake up earlier. Ji Kangzi then asked Confucius, what if I kill those who do evil and get close to those who cultivate virtue and do good?It's too cruel to hear this kind of words.An American political scientist said that the most important thing in politics is to avoid cruelty.A person who holds great power will kill bad people at every turn, but he has overlooked one point. No one is born a bad person. A bad person is caused by the combination of social environment, education system and other factors to make him go on an evil path.In other words, bad people degenerate from ordinary people into bad people, and good people become good people through the efforts of ordinary people. People cannot be simply divided into dichotomies. Confucius said to him: "If you govern, how can you use killing? If you want to be good, the people are good. The virtue of a gentleman is the virtue of a villain. The wind on the grass must die." ("The Analects of Confucius Yan Yuan") Confucius replied Said: "You are in charge of politics, why kill people? If you want to do good, the people will follow suit. The words and deeds of political leaders are like the wind; the words and deeds of ordinary people are like grass; when the wind blows on the grass, the grass It must come down." Confucius has a concept of trend. For example, we say that the world has no way or the world has way. No way means that the world is moving towards a chaotic world without way, and having a way means that the world is moving towards a proper rule of the world. Both are a trend, and it is impossible to divide black and white .The same is true for human beings, who are free and can do good or evil.Obviously there are severe punishments and strict laws, but they still do evil, which shows that there are great incentives for evil.One of the triggers is the failure to educate, and this is the responsibility of the leader. But Ji Kangzi, a young high official, thought that as long as the violators were killed, the problem would be solved.Killing seems to be a word, and it can kill a person casually.In fact, all the way through the Spring and Autumn and Warring States period, there were too many wars, the lives of ordinary people were too worthless, and killing people became a very common thing.Confucius could not accept this idea at all.He said that you are in charge of politics, why do you need to kill people?If you are willing to walk on the right path, the people will naturally follow you to do good deeds. This is called "the wind moves the grass", the leader behaves like the "wind", and the common people behave like "grass". East, the grass will fall to the east, rather it is very natural.This is exactly what we often say "the superiors and the inferiors will work together" or what Mencius said "the ones who are good at the top must have those who are inferior". What the people in the top position like, the people at the bottom will intensify their efforts to win the favor of the leaders. , which is a common situation in society. Confucius' intention is to hope that leaders "lead by example", break the pattern of class antagonism, and work together to pursue a beautiful, virtuous and harmonious life.He said: "Government is governed by virtue, such as the North Star, where the stars live." ("Analects of Confucius") You use virtue to govern the country, just like the North Star, the position of the North Star does not move (the North Star is in the The ancients believed that it was motionless, of course today's astronomy tells us that there is no completely motionless planet in the universe, because you can't find a fixed point to measure whether it is moving or not), and other stars surround it in their own place Bit, both harmonious and orderly.If you govern the country with virtue, you don't have to do anything yourself, and the world will be on track.The Master said: "Shun is the one who governs without doing anything! What is the husband doing? Just respect yourself and face the south." ("The Analects of Confucius Wei Linggong") Shun just sat on the throne with a dignified and respectful attitude, and governed the country well up.Why?Because when he governs the country, he first cultivates his own virtue, and the ruler becomes a model of goodness, and the common people will move in the direction of goodness.Therefore, those in power must not think about killing people casually, and killing all the bad guys can govern the country well.If this method is established, I am afraid that there will not be many people left in many countries.How should I do it?Through education and political methods, let the common people go on the right path.No one is born a bad person, everyone has hope to walk on the right path.It's just that leaders need to find the correct system design so that everyone can live a more stable life. Therefore, "acting from above to below effect" comes from the basic concept of "human nature tends to be good".Once the "virtue" of the superior is manifested, people's hearts will naturally be willing to obey, and if they arrange their lives toward "goodness", the world will naturally be peaceful.On the contrary, if people in positions of power do evil, will ordinary people also do evil?This is a big question.Confucius believed that this was not true.If people in high positions do evil, the common people will be very angry, which may lead to chaos in the world.
